在queue.conf中设置setinterfacevar=yes以启用MEMBERINTERFACE变量;
然后在extension.conf呼叫queue时调用一个agi脚本
(用参数,Queue(myqueue|t|||10|agi://192.168.35.3/hello.agi)
exten => _X., n, Queue(911|tT|||60|Predictive/sayinterface.agi)
这样就可以在agi中用getVariable(“MEMBERINTERFACE”)获取接通的那个queue member名称
<?phpinclude (dirname(__FILE__)."/phpagi_2_14/phpagi.php");i<div style="color:transparent">!本文来源gaodai.ma#com搞##代!^码网(</div><sup>搞gaodaima代码</sup>nclude (dirname(__FILE__)."/phpagi_2_14/phpagi-asmanager.php");$agi=new AGI();$temp=$agi->get_variable("MEMBERINTERFACE");$member=$temp['data'];$member=substr($member,4);$agi->verbose($member);$agi->say_digits($member);?>